Google обновляет около 1000 смайлов в Android 12

В Android 12 добавляются новые смайлы, и их можно будет обновлять без обновления ОС. Приложения могут сами обновлять свои смайлы!

Эмодзи стали важным средством передачи эмоций и намерений при обмене сообщениями, особенно из-за сложности передачи вашего тона с помощью слов. В стандарт Unicode часто добавляются новые смайлы, и обычно необходимо выпускать обновления ОС для поддержки этих новых смайлов на системном уровне. Google работал над сделать файл шрифта, содержащий новые смайлы, обновляемым без необходимости обновления системы Android, и сегодня компания намекнула, что это особенность Андроид 12.

В сообщении в блогеGoogle также объявил, что были затронуты сотни маленьких забавных значков — 992, если быть точным. были усовершенствованы и улучшены, чтобы сделать их более универсальными, доступными и аутентичными, а также появились новые, слишком. Например, смайлик «пирог» теперь менее американский и относится к «пирогу», который знает большая часть мира, а не к тыквенному пирогу.

По данным Google, все приложения, поддерживающие библиотеку Appcompat, будут автоматически получать последние смайлы от Google. Независимо от того, сколько лет вашему телефону или сколько времени потребуется на обновление ваших приложений, начиная с Android 12, вы получите самые последние смайлы в приложениях, использующих Appcompat. В настоящее время вы можете получить новый

Смайлы Android 12 на любом устройстве Android с root-правами, но рутирование явно не так уж и удобно для пользователя. Нет ничего проще, чем заставить ваши приложения автоматически получать все новые смайлы.

Наши друзья в Андроид Полиция покопался, чтобы узнать больше об этом объявлении. Если вы давно следите за Android, отделение смайлов от системы Android может показаться вам знакомым. Это определенно прозвучало для меня, и я не был уверен, почему. Оказывается, еще в 2017 году Google сказал почти то же самое, когда анонсировал библиотека поддержки под названием «EmojiCompat» который работал на уровне API 19 или выше (Android 4.4+). Этим пользуются сторонние приложения, такие как Gboard и Google Messages (и именно поэтому вы можете получать новые смайлы в Gboard), но очень немногие сторонние приложения это делают. По сути, это может быть не часть системы, а скорее то, на что разработчикам необходимо дать свое согласие. Таким образом, нам неясно, действительно ли сегодняшнее объявление связано с недавно добавленной поддержкой обновления файлов шрифтов через сервисы Google Play.

Когда Андроид Полиция обратился в Google, они спросили почему основной модуль вместо этого не был реализован. «Основная линия» в данном случае будет означать, что она является частью основных служб Android, но вместо этого это изменение, ориентированное на ядро ​​GMS, которое является частью Служб Google Play и Андроид Джетпак. Ответ Google сводился к заявлению, что изменение, интегрированное в ядро ​​GMS, не требует «никакой дополнительной работы со стороны разработчиков», и что соблюдение подхода EmojiCompat означает, что «он будет работать на старых устройствах». Однако при этом игнорируется тот факт, что Google специально рекламирует это как изменение Android 12.

Отделение смайлов от системы Android было тем, к чему призывали многие люди в течение долгого времени. Всякий раз, когда выпускаются новые и пользователи iPhone получают их первыми, вы, скорее всего, в конечном итоге будете недопонимать из-за отсутствия контекста смайликов, которые могут быть использованы на другой стороне. Поскольку они считаются «шрифтами», и шрифты, наконец, можно будет обновлять в разделе /data на смартфоне Android, вы мощь сможете получать обновления, которые в будущем будут включать смайлы, через Сервисы Google Play.

В любом случае, обновляемые смайлы — это улучшение качества жизни, которое некоторым людям может показаться глупым, но, учитывая, как смайлы стали такой значительной частью нашего разговорного языка, что для них важно, чтобы их можно было легко обновлять и доводить до скорости в любое время. необходимый. В любом случае мы надеемся, что это определенно часть уравнения.